News FCC plans vote on Anterix proposal for 900 MHz private LTE for utilities, enterprises 22nd April 2020 FCC commissioners next month are expected to approve rules that would let Anterix transition its narrowband LMR spectrum in the 900 MHz band to a contiguous block of private LTE airwaves designed to support mission-critical broadband applications for utilities and other enterprises. Partner content Utility giant Ameren moving forward with private LTE network 18th April 2020 For the past two years, utility provider Ameren has been testing a private LTE network with equipment from Nokia and CommScope and spectrum from AT&T and Anterix.
